About Elliptic Laboratories ASA

https://ellipticlabs.com/home/

Elliptic Laboratories ASA is an artificial intelligence software company that develops the AI Virtual Smart Sensor Platform™, a software-only solution providing contextual intelligence to devices. The platform utilizes proprietary deep neural networks, ultrasound, and sensor-fusion to create AI-powered Virtual Smart Sensors. These virtual sensors replace the need for dedicated hardware components, delivering capabilities such as human-presence detection, proximity sensing, and touchless interaction. The technology targets the smartphone, laptop, IoT, and automotive markets, enabling manufacturers to enhance user experiences, personalization, and privacy. By interpreting data from existing device sensors, the platform makes technology more intuitive and responsive to its environment and users.
